In this article, the accomplishment of OFDM systems under different jamming attacks is analyzed. Partial band jamming signal suppressing OFDM data packets partially and full band jamming signal suppressing all OFDM data packets are examined in this study. Computer simulation works are carried out to analyze the achievement of the OFDM system over AWGN and frequency selective Rayleigh fading channels under both jamming attacks. In addition, comparative performance analysis of different equalizer structures in frequency selective Rayleigh fading channel environment is performed. From the obtained results, it is seen that frequency domain equalizers combat jamming attack signals in the best way and provide the best performances.
